Sulphonate additives are widely used in the automotive industry to enhance the performance and longevity of lubricants, engine oils, and fuel additives. These additives help to improve the viscosity, reduce friction, and offer better wear resistance in engines, which in turn leads to higher fuel efficiency and reduced emissions. Furthermore, sulphonate-based additives provide crucial protection against corrosion and rust formation in engine components. Their ability to neutralize acidic compounds and prevent deposits within the engine is a major factor in extending the life of automotive engines. In the metalworking industry, sulphonate additives play a crucial role in the formulation of metalworking fluids such as coolants, cutting oils, and hydraulic fluids. These additives serve multiple functions, including improving the lubrication properties of the fluids, enhancing heat dissipation, and preventing rust and corrosion on metal surfaces during the machining or grinding processes. Sulphonate additives also assist in reducing friction between metal parts, which in turn minimizes wear and tear on equipment, thus prolonging the life of both the tools and the machinery. Their ability to enhance the anti-wear properties of metalworking fluids is highly valued, especially in heavy-duty machining applications that involve high pressure and temperature conditions. The "Others" category for sulphonate additives encompasses a broad range of applications across industries such as oil and gas, textiles, agriculture, and paints & coatings. In the oil and gas industry, sulphonate additives are essential for enhancing the performance of drilling fluids, which are used in both onshore and offshore drilling operations. These additives improve the stability of the fluids, prevent corrosion of equipment, and enhance the efficiency of drilling processes. In textiles, sulphonate-based surfactants are used in dyeing and finishing processes to improve fabric quality. In agriculture, these additives are used in pesticide formulations to increase the effectiveness of active ingredients. In the paints and coatings industry, sulphonate additives contribute to enhancing the durability, adhesion, and weather resistance of coatings.
